
Venezuela Flights Return after Seven Years
According to CNN, the first commercial flight from the United States to Venezuela in nearly seven years has now landed in Caracas.
Reuters also reported that American Airlines resumed direct Miami-Caracas service, making this more than a travel headline.
It is a visible sign that Venezuela is beginning to reconnect with the hemisphere after years of dictatorship, isolation, and collapse.
